Description

Descend into the Crossword Dungeon, where every level is made up of a procedurally-generated crossword, and each letter guarded by a vile monster you must best!

Guess the correct letter to instantly dispatch the monster, or risk combat damage if incorrect.

Test your wits against crosswords of increasing complexity and monsters with deadly abilities with one of three classes with their own unique skills:

The Barbarian, a muscled berserker who lives for the thrill of battle and feeds his rage with the blood of his enemies.

The Ranger, a feared hunter who uses a deadly combination of marksmanship and tracking instincts.

And the Scoundrel, a ne'er-do-well who makes the best of limited resources and subverts enemies' defenses with stealth attacks.

...each in search of riches and glory beneath the Crossword Dungeon.

Good concept, dull game

I really liked the idea of a rogue/crossword hybrid but unfortunately this is far to much average crossword and very little rogue.

You'll wander around small crossword boards that slowly get bigger as you descend levels. I noticed the clues repeated in the few games I played. The clues aren't particularly taxing but since free movement isn't allowed unless you kill the monsters in your path you probably won't be doing much back-solving if you get stumped.

Killing a mob consists of picking one of a selection of letters. the correct letter is a crit and fills in the square, the wrong letter is a swing which allows the mob to attack back. If this sounds fun then I described it wrong.

From an RPG perspective the game is weaker. You level, choose something like strength or constitution or stun resistance and keep going. There are 3 classes but they didn't seem to change the pace of the game.

I would recommend avoiding this. I personally think Bookworm Adventures is still the best word/RPG hybrid you can play.
